    That being said, it is not unusual to see spikes and declines in traffic, for example when content is being featured on Google Discover. At the same time, Google Search is constantly improving its algorithms, which can affect ranking. Linking to / embedding stories from other places on your sites and following the recommendations from the pre-publish checklist is a good way to ensure your users will find your stories.

    If you’re not sure whether a change in traffic is caused by a change to your site, use Search Console’s various tools to see if your content is properly crawled and indexed. The help resources at Google Search Central can further help debug cases like this.
